Transaction 2a507c39a91b4db094864e6182e4b229f907dec2a934f2550e151081479da508
1 Input
2 Outputs
- 2a507c39a91b4db094864e6182e4b229f907dec2a934f2550e151081479da508:0
- 2a507c39a91b4db094864e6182e4b229f907dec2a934f2550e151081479da508:1
value 558792
address 3P44iMoo3vh8VjpQubemPgsqTAoB6gBi4G
value 1362799
address 1HBTA6VTgz2NcHLe5cuxiMBu8Uf9sqt876